The Versatile 45ft Cargo Container: Meeting the Demands of Global Trade
In the huge and intricate world of worldwide trade, the cargo container stands as a pivotal element, facilitating the efficient and safe transport of items throughout the world. Amongst the different sizes and types of containers, the 45-foot (45ft) cargo container has actually become a popular choice for lots of markets. This post looks into the characteristics, advantages, and applications of the 45ft cargo container, supplying a thorough summary of its role in modern logistics.
What is a 45ft Cargo Container?
A 45ft cargo container, likewise called a 45-foot container, is a standard-sized shipping container that determines 45 feet in length, 8 feet in width, and 9.5 feet in height. These dimensions offer a significant internal volume, making it a perfect choice for transporting large amounts of products. Unlike the more common 20-foot and 40-foot containers, the 45ft container uses an extra 5 feet of length, which can be important for certain cargo types.

Secret Characteristics of 45ft Cargo Containers
Internal Dimensions:
- Length: 45 feet (13.716 meters)
- Width: 8 feet (2.438 meters)
- Height: 8 feet 6 inches (2.591 meters) for standard height and 9 feet 6 inches (2.9 meters) for high cube containers.
External Dimensions:
- Length: 45 feet 1 inch (13.716 meters)
- Width: 8 feet (2.438 meters)
- Height: 9 feet 6 inches (2.9 meters) for high cube containers.
Capacity:
- Standard Height: Approximately 3,600 cubic feet (100 cubic meters)
- High Cube: Approximately 3,960 cubic feet (112 cubic meters)
Weight:
- Tare Weight (empty weight): About 8,900 pounds (4,040 kg)
- Payload (max weight of cargo): Up to 65,600 pounds (29,760 kg)
Benefits of Using 45ft Cargo Containers
Increased Capacity:
- The extra 5 feet of length in a 45ft container permits for more cargo to be packed. This is particularly helpful for bulk goods, machinery, and other big products that might not fit effectively in a 40-foot container.
Affordable:
- Despite being longer, the 45ft container often provides a more cost-efficient service compared to using 2 20-foot containers. The decreased handling and transport costs can lead to substantial savings.
Versatility:
- These containers can be utilized for a wide variety of items, from consumer products to heavy machinery. They are available in different types, consisting of dry, cooled, and open-top, to fulfill particular cargo needs.
Improved Efficiency:
- The bigger size allows for less container moves, which can streamline logistics and lower the threat of damage throughout handling. This is particularly useful for long-distance and international shipments.
Applications of 45ft Cargo Containers
Bulk Goods:
- The increased volume is perfect for transporting bulk products such as paper, wood, and plastics. These goods often require a large quantity of area and can be packed more effectively in a 45ft container.
Heavy Machinery:
- Large and heavy equipment, such as building and construction devices and industrial tools, can be transported more quickly in a 45ft container. The additional length and height offer the essential area for these large items.
Automotive Parts:
- The vehicle market frequently uses 45ft containers to carry parts and components. The extra space enables better organization and defense of fragile parts.
Refrigerated Cargo:
- For disposable products requiring temperature level control, 45ft cooled containers are available. These containers are geared up with advanced cooling systems to maintain optimum conditions during transport.
Retail and Consumer Goods:
- Many retail business utilize 45ft containers to ship big orders of durable goods, such as clothing, electronic devices, and home devices. The increased capacity assists to fulfill the high need for these products.
Obstacles and Considerations
Port and Terminal Constraints:
- Not all ports and terminals are geared up to handle 45ft containers due to their size. Carriers need to ensure that the destination and intermediate ports have the essential infrastructure to accommodate these containers.
Transport Regulations:
- Road and rail transportation policies might differ by nation. Shippers should abide by regional laws and guidelines to prevent charges and hold-ups.
Packing and Unloading:
- The bigger size of 45ft containers can make loading and discharging more tough. Specialized equipment and trained workers may be needed to deal with these containers effectively.

Kinds Of 45ft Cargo Containers
Dry Containers:
- These are the most typical type and are used for the transport of general cargo that does not need temperature control.
Refrigerated Containers:
- Designed to keep a particular temperature, these containers are necessary for transferring perishable items such as food, pharmaceuticals, and chemicals.
Open-Top Containers:
- These containers have a detachable top, enabling the loading of high or bulky items that can not fit through a basic door. They are ideal for construction materials and equipment.
Flat-Rack Containers:
- Flat-rack containers have no sides or roofing, making them suitable for large and heavy cargo such as automobiles, boats, and industrial equipment.
Tank Containers:
- These specialized containers are used for the transportation of liquid and gaseous items. They are usually made from steel and are geared up with valves and determines for safe handling.
